Green Roofs for a sustainable city ALB/SGP/OP6/Y2/CORE/CC/17/01
One of the main environmental shortcomings perceived by the inhabitants of the capital city of Tirana, Albania is the lack of green areas inside the city itself. As the result, the increase of the green areas is one of the most sought after results of every new municipal administration. The current administration has identified the building of the green roofs as one of the activities that they will support in order to mitigate the above mentioned problem. SGP sees in this occasion an opportunity in promotion of environmentally sustainable technology that has a good potential for replication.
Green roof is a roof of a building that is partially or completely covered with vegetation and a growing medium, planted over a waterproofing membrane. Green roofs serve several purposes for a building, such as absorbing rainwater, providing insulation, creating a habitat for wildlife, increasing benevolence and decreasing stress of the people around the roof by providing a more aesthetically pleasing landscape, and helping to lower urban air temperatures and mitigate the heat island effect.
The project will be implemented on the roof area of the Faculty of Architecture and Urban Planning benefiting from the technical expertise of the academic staff and also acting as a laboratory for the student curricula.
